Mental illness can look like a lot of things, such as depression, bipolar disorder, or substance use disorder. Actually, these conditions are some of the most common struggles among Americans. The definition of mental illness is the presence of health conditions involving changes in emotions, thoughts, and behavior. Instances of mental illness may be identified by distress or issues in social settings, work, and family relationships. Diagnosing and treating mental illnesses is possible, but evaluations need to be conducted by trained and experienced mental health care providers in Waterloo, OR such as psychiatrists, psychologists, and mental health counselors. Treatment varies but may include a combination of behavioral therapy, support group meetings, and life skills development.

Mental Health in Waterloo, OR - What is Mental Health

Mental health is defined as the condition of our emotional, cognitive, and behavioral state. Simply put: It’s our mental state. It can impact everything from how we think and feel, to how we act and how our bodies respond to certain situations and stimuli.

Our mental health can have a significant impact on our overall quality of life, affecting daily activities and relationships at work, at home, and in our love lives. It impacts our self-esteem, changes how we make choices, our ability to communicate, and even our learning capabilities.

Even though we cannot technically see or measure it, our mental health directly relates to how we interact with the rest of the world. How our minds operate, ultimately makes us who we are as individuals.

Paying for Waterloo Mental Health Rehab

Everything costs something - including mental healthcare The cost of housing, medication, therapy, and all other aspects of recovery can add up. Someone has to pay them. In the United States, the most common method of paying for any type of health care is insurance. However, this isn’t the only option. Additional payment options include government healthcare, self-pay, scholarships, and free programs:

  • Private Insurance can be purchased through your employer or your spouse/parent’s employer. Private insurance can also be purchased directly from the insurance provider.
  • Subsidized Private Insurance is available through healthcare.gov to people who have a low income, but also do not qualify for medicare/medicaid.
  • Medicare - A government-funded healthcare option available to individuals over the age of 65.
  • Medicaid - A government-funded healthcare option available to low-income individuals and families.Medicare/Medicaid- Government-funded healthcare options for those below a certain income or over the age of 65.
  • Self-payment] - Those who have the financial means may pay for their mental health treatment Waterloo out-of-pocket. Payment plans and credit options may be available for self-pay clients.
  • Scholarships - Some mental health providers Waterloo offer a scholarship for individuals who express a great want and dedication to getting better, but otherwise would not have the financial means] to pay for [the treatment they need.
  • “Free” Programs - Private and public not-for-profit organizations use the funds to provide mental health treatment to their local community. However, it is common to see a long waitlist in areas with high demand for these services.
